Deontay Wilder: No more feared, says Hearn


Eddie Hearn says fighters no longer fear Deontay Wilder, as his career has sunk for the past five years. He says the former WBC heavyweight champion Wilder (43-4-1, 42 costs) is a classic example of a ‘fighter who loses his way’.

Hearn does not say why 39-year-old Deontay’s career has evaporated since 2020, but it is logical to assume that he is getting rich and a fortune of $ 30 million Out of his three fights with Tyson Fury had something to do with it.

The other part is that he is overestimated, just like Fury and Anthony Joshua. Fans saw all three as great talents, but it was all smoking and mirrors created by matchmaking. Promoters can make any fighter wonderful with the right guidance.

Deontay has lost four out of his last five battles since 2020, and will try to rejuvenate his career Tyrrell Anthony Herndon Next month on June 27 at the Charles Koch Arena in Wichita, Kansas. Few fans have heard of Herndon (24-5, 15, which shows how far Wilder’s career has fallen. For him to fit against this level of opposition through his promoters, it is desperation to keep him going.

Hearn: Wilder’s lost fear

“It’s not a battle I exclude, but people don’t give a great chance against AJ right now, but hopefully he can look good again,” Eddie Hearn said Fighting type On whether there is a chance for the Deontay Wilder against Anthony Joshua, fighting so late in their careers.

Deontay turns 40 in October, has not won a fight in three years and comes from back-to-back defeats. At this point, he may not win his next battle against little well -known Tyrrell Herndon on June 27. It is doubtful whether Wilder’s problems are the result of age, decline of his three fights against Tyson Fury, or gentle life to become one of the super -rich.

“Once again we are talking about Fighters lose their way. There is a wonderful example. It’s funny how people are so scared of a fighter, and then suddenly no fear, ‘says Hearn.

Deontay stopped being feared by fighters after his seventh round loss to the slapper Fury in 2020.

You could not take the version of Fury and bring him into this era with one of the top heavyweights and expect him to do the same thing. It was an excellent version of Fury, but he had the perfect opponent to look better than him.

Deontay was never a good heavyweight, but was positioned to conquer the WBC heavyweight title by being linked to the vulnerable fighter Bermane Stiverne. Deontay then milked his WBC title by defending it against poor opposition for five years before losing it in 2020.

“I don’t think anyone would fear he was fighting Deontay Wilder now, while everyone at one point thought,” Oh my God, this man is the biggest puncher in the history of the sport. “Now everyone wants to fight against him,” says Hearn.

The younger fighters do not fear Wilder or 35-year-old Anthony Joshua, both are considered old fossils. If Hearn AJ removed from the protective mode, he would be food for most of the top heavyweights in the division. It is clear that he will not make it happen, but that is what would happen. Joshua is now just as defeated as Wilder, and is not feared by no one.

Nostalgia about talent

“If he keeps winning, people might talk about the fight again,” Hearn says about a match between Deontay and Joshua.

Wilder will not continue to win unless he is linked to terrible opposition. At this point, the only way a battle between him and AJ takes place is if done for the same reason, Joshua’s likely clash against Fury. In other words, for money to give sentimental older fans, the battles they have seen all these years.

Joshua-Wilder and Joshua-Fury Fights will not echo with younger fans because they do not consider these guys the latest heavyweights. They see them as old remains, such as the Ford Model T car.
